Would it be feasible to attempt a similar repair without the use of a microscope?
@Mark_C1
@Mark_C1 Год назад
IMO it’s not impossible but highly unlikely. When the components get down to that size it’s so hard to see them clearly with the naked eye. With a over head magnifier it’s doable but then you start struggling on working height with the soldering iron or heat gun and fogging up the glass with breath while concentrating. Maybe a set of surgeons loupes would work ok but by that point you’re better off getting a half decent microscope. Not that expensive and really make life sooo much easier !

@xxJerry19xx
@xxJerry19xx Год назад
Bigger is not always better. Bigger capacitor will crack soner than smaller on PCB bending test. It depends also on capacity. High capacity means lot of layers and more fragile capacitor.
